Taiwan reviews Papua New Guinea LNG imports after economic office’s forced closure

Asia-Pacific 1 source 1 country 🔦 Under-reported 40m ago

Taiwan is reviewing liquefied natural gas (LNG) imports from Papua New Guinea after the Pacific nation said it would close Taipei’s unofficial representative office. PNG announced last week that it would immediately shut down the office, with Foreign Minister Justin Tkatchenko saying the move reflected the government’s “unwavering commitment to the one-China policy” ahead of the 50th anniversary of the country’s diplomatic ties with Beijing.
